Duration: 12 months full-time or 24 months part-time (MLitt); 9 months full-time or 18 months part-time (PgDip). Content: Candidates undertake the following: EL 5013 Research Methods in Language and Linguistics (10 credit points) Or HI 5053 Introduction to Historical Research (20 credit points) Or HI 5029 Medieval Texts and Manuscripts (20 credit points) And Courses from an extensive list which, along with the above, total 120 credit points, with the approval of the Programme Co-ordinator. Courses should normally total 60 credit points in each half-session. Note: Unless prior proficiency can be demonstrated, HI 5016 Basic Latin for Historians (20 credit points) and HI 5516 Intermediate Latin for Postgraduates (20 credit points), are compulsory. Masters Stage HI 5529 Medieval Studies Dissertation I: Sources and Source Criticism (60 credit points) HI 5903 Dissertation in Medieval Studies (MLitt) (60 credit points) Assessment: By course work, by written examination, or by a combination of these, as prescribed for each course. Candidates who proceed to the Masters stage will be required to submit a dissertation on a topic agreed in advance with their supervisor. The degree of MLitt shall not be awarded to a candidate who fails to achieve a CAS mark of 9 in HI 5903, irrespective of their performance in other courses. A Programme Monitoring Committee will scrutinise students essay marks and adjudicate on their eligibility to proceed to the dissertation, which reference to their overall abilities, particularly in their primary research field. 2K     = ?
